ASEAN+3 Regional Financial Safety Net and IMF: Time for Structured Cooperation
The regional financial safety net (RFSN) that the ASEAN+3 countries have been establishing during the last two decades can only be successful if it evolves into a more structured form of cooperation with the IMF.
